India recorded a total of 2,76,583 cases of the Novel Coronavirus or COVID-19 with a recovery rate of 49%  till the 10th of June .

On the morning of the 10th of June, the Union Health Ministry confirmed 9,985 new cases of COVID-19 in the past 24 hours.  While India crossed  2,76,583 positive cases, deaths due to the Coronavirus infection stood at 7,745 including 279 deaths in the past 24 hours.

The number of patients recovered till date  in India are 1,34,166.

The Union Home Ministry announced Unlock 1.0., allowing re opening of shopping malls, restaurants and religious places in  Red, Orange and Green zones.  However, containment zones, especially in 13 cities of India would be under the lockdown 5.0., till the 30th of June.  

On the 4th of June, the Ministry of Home Affairs, released a set of guidelines for all the restaurants, religious places and shopping malls, which resumed functioning from the 8th of June, across India. 

However, considering the situation, the Maharashtra Government did not allow shopping malls, religious places and restaurants to open.  Meghalaya Government also held the opening of religious places and the West Bengal Government extended the lockdown in the containment zones with strict rules.

Maharashtra, Tamil Nadu, Delhi, Gujarat, Rajasthan are the Indian states which are reporting high numbers of COVID-19 cases and are the worst hit .

Maharashtra has 90, 787cases, Tamil Nadu has 34,914 cases, Delhi (29,943) Gujarat (21,044,) Rajasthan (11,245,) Uttar Pradesh (11,335,) Madhya Pradesh (9,849) and West Bengal (8,985.) 

On the 7th of June, India became the 5th worst hit COVID-19 affected nation.  The other four are the United States of America, Brazil, Russia and the United Kingdom (U.K.)
